Identify Cross-Team Dependencies Before They Become Delivery Risks
Dependencies are a natural part of building complex solutions, but they often don't become visible until they're already impacting delivery.
This workflow uses AI to analyze work across multiple teams and identify potential dependencies before planning is complete, giving teams more time to coordinate, reduce risk, and make informed decisions.

⚙️ How It Works
Step 1: Gather planning information
Collect the planning artifacts that describe the work each team is preparing to deliver.
Examples include:
- Draft PI Objectives
- Feature descriptions
- Team backlogs
- Capability descriptions
- Architecture runway items
- Enabler Features
- Existing dependency boards (if available)
Upload these documents into NotebookLM.
The more complete your planning information, the easier it becomes to identify relationships between teams.
Step 2: Look for connections across teams
Instead of reviewing each team's work independently, ask NotebookLM to analyze all of the planning information together.
Try prompts like:
- Which teams appear to be working on related capabilities?
- Are multiple teams relying on the same system or component?
- Where might sequencing become important?
- Which Features appear to require work from multiple teams?
- Are there dependencies that haven't been explicitly documented?
- Which teams should coordinate before PI Planning begins?
NotebookLM is particularly effective at connecting information spread across multiple documents that would otherwise require hours of manual review.
Step 3: Turn observations into a dependency plan
Once NotebookLM has identified potential dependencies, copy those findings into ChatGPT.
Ask ChatGPT to:
- Group related dependencies together
- Identify the highest-risk dependencies
- Explain why each dependency matters
- Suggest conversations the teams should have
- Recommend mitigation strategies
- Create a simple dependency summary that can be shared during PI Planning
This transforms a long list of observations into something your ART can actually use.
Step 4: Validate with the teams
AI can suggest likely dependencies—but only the teams doing the work can confirm whether those dependencies actually exist.
Use the AI-generated summary to guide conversations with Product Management, Scrum Masters, Architects, and delivery teams.
The objective isn't to replace dependency mapping—it's to help teams discover important conversations earlier.
💡 Why Agile Pros Care
Dependencies are one of the most common causes of delayed delivery, changing priorities, and planning surprises.
By analyzing planning artifacts before PI Planning begins, teams can identify coordination opportunities early, reduce delivery risk, and spend more time solving problems instead of uncovering them.
AI won't eliminate dependencies—but it can help ensure fewer of them come as a surprise.
💬 Prompt to Copy
You are an experienced Release Train Engineer supporting PI Planning.Review the planning information below and identify potential dependencies across teams.Specifically:
- Identify work that appears connected across multiple teams.
- Highlight sequencing dependencies.
- Identify shared systems, components, or Features.
- Flag areas where coordination may be required.
- Rank the highest-risk dependencies.
- Suggest mitigation strategies.
- Recommend discussion topics for PI Planning breakout sessions.
Present the results as a Dependency Planning Guide that can be shared with Scrum Masters, Product Management, and Business Owners before PI Planning begins.Planning Information: Paste your NotebookLM summary here.

AI can quickly uncover patterns across large amounts of information, but it doesn't understand the full context of your organization. Use AI to surface potential dependencies and start better conversations, then rely on your teams to validate assumptions and determine the best path forward.
